Transaction 0535470ec9623278609b63dc7acc8ea56f1203262f97906a2f882b74403171fd
1 Input
2 Outputs
- 0535470ec9623278609b63dc7acc8ea56f1203262f97906a2f882b74403171fd:0
- 0535470ec9623278609b63dc7acc8ea56f1203262f97906a2f882b74403171fd:1
value 949
address 38et5XaKPTEZjjjXuWNSNbJC273a1x7YFt
value 1311854
address 1F7oUu39rB2vfV8LjfhtrZ96VijqthwUUB